Super Micro: Fiscal Q2 Earnings Snapshot and Market Implications

Super Micro Computer Inc. (SMCI) has reported its fiscal second-quarter earnings, delivering a strong performance that has caught the attention of investors and analysts alike. The San Jose, California-based company announced earnings of $320.6 million for the quarter, reinforcing its position as a key player in the high-performance computing and server solutions industry.
